Recently, singer Mujtaba Aziz Naza revealed details about the three specific songs that were supposedly decided to be the part of the film. The singer said that last year, he recorded the song ‘Dongri Ke Sultan.’ The song was shot extensively in a set in South Mumbai, but it's now missing from the final cut of the action drama. The singer also revealed that everything was finalized, even Ranveer Singh’s final look for the song.
The singer said, "We shot three songs, “Dongri Ke Sultan," a cover of "Jumma Chumma De De," and "Apni To Jaise Taise." The set-up was spectacular. He also revealed Aditya Dhar had decided that in the song Ranveer Singh and Rakesh Bedi were shown in a car, while a band performed on a truck. The song was shot in one day. It was a grand affair, with Hamza returning after winning the election, along with a large audience. There were at least 10 cars. We shot it in South Mumbai one day last Ramadan 2025." He further explains.
Regarding this entire matter, Mujtaba Aziz Naza said, “I don't know why we had to remove those songs. They edited out the entire portion." However, he also stated that he still holds the rights to the song and is now planning to release it independently. He says, “My song was included in the film, but it wasn't released. So I decided to make an official video for it. Because the film had the audio, not the video. We're also working on the video, and we're making a very exclusive video. The video for 'Dongri Ke Sultan' will be launched very soon.” said Mujtava Aziz Naza.
